My photo of tonight's launch of "Owl the Way Up"! by Xatzimi in RocketLab

[–]Xatzimi[S] 7 points8 points  (0 children)

Definitely visible to the naked eye. I've heard people can just look out and see it as far as Napier. My camera was completely zoomed out, no fancy lenses, just a 60s exposure. The site is about 25km directly across the water from Blacks Beach. At night, it was easy to follow the exhaust plume all the way to MECO and second stage ignition. Wasn't able to see the rocket itself at night, it's black after all anyway. Also didn't hear anything, at least not over the waves. It was mostly like a bright shooting star going in reverse. If you do go at night, the site is easy to spot as you can see the pad lights at the tip of the peninsula. I haven't seen a day Electron launch, so I don't know if it would be easier or harder to view but I imagine the exhaust is still the most visible part of it. You might get to see a few black dots move apart at stage separation but it's a tiny rocket. Good idea to bring binoculars if you have any.

Keep in mind it's not the same spectacle Falcon is, which itself was tame compared to the Shuttle. I've seen a Falcon launch from the closest public access at only about 5 miles. From there you can practically read the logo on the rocket, you can hear it, and you can see stage separation very well. Electron is only 18m tall though! But it's still a good sight to see. It's honestly worth going just to remember New Zealand has a space programme!

After the launch finishes up, I suggest a stop into Mahia's Rocket Cafe or the Sunset Point pub, both of which have memorabilia. If you're so inclined you can also drive most of the way down Mahia East Coast Rd and actually view the launch site, though the road is closed off during launch windows.
